Israel Strikes Residential Areas, Destroys Homes in Southern Lebanon Amid Rising Crises

Recent military actions by Israel in southern Lebanon have resulted in significant destruction of residential areas, leading to the loss of homes and escalating tensions in the region. The strikes have not only caused physical damage but are also intensifying the humanitarian crisis faced by the local population.

According to reports from the United Nations, Lebanon is currently experiencing more than just a displacement crisis due to the ongoing conflict. The escalating violence has severely disrupted normal life, causing many people to flee their homes in search of safety. This displacement has put immense pressure on both local communities and aid organizations striving to meet the urgent needs of the affected populations.

Furthermore, the situation is rapidly developing into a food security crisis. The instability has hindered the availability and accessibility of food supplies, aggravating conditions for many families who are already vulnerable. The combined impacts of displacement and food shortages threaten to deepen the humanitarian emergency in Lebanon.

The destruction of homes and infrastructure has compounded the difficulties faced by residents in southern Lebanon. Many families have been forced into temporary shelters or overcrowded facilities, where access to basic services remains limited. This displacement not only disrupts daily life but also poses long-term challenges for rebuilding and recovery.

The UN has called for immediate international attention and assistance to address these overlapping crises. Efforts are needed to provide food relief, medical aid, and shelter to those affected, as well as to support local authorities in managing the situation.

The conflict’s impact extends beyond physical destruction, affecting social cohesion and economic stability in the region. Reconstruction will require sustained support and collaboration from the international community to ensure that families can return safely to their homes and regain a sense of normalcy.

In summary, the recent Israeli strikes targeting residential zones in southern Lebanon have triggered a multi-faceted humanitarian crisis characterized by widespread displacement and a looming food security emergency. Without urgent intervention, the plight of affected communities is likely to worsen, underscoring the critical need for coordinated global efforts to deliver aid and foster peace in the region.
